Research Project: FOOD SAFETY PATHOGEN REDUCTION Project Number: 0500-00058-001-00
Project Type: Appropriated

Start Date: Dec 01, 2003
End Date: Nov 30, 2008

Objective:
This is an umbrella project to hold food safety funds. FY1999 Program increase for food safety. Modified Start and Termination dates from 12/01/1998 through 11/30/2003 to 12/01/2003 through 11/30/2008. To reduce the public health risk due to Listeria monocytogenes and Escherichia coli and other food pathogens. Generate data on Listeria and Escherichia coli 0157:H7 and other food pathogens for use by regulatory/action agencies and industry.

Approach:
These funds will be used for extramural research with (1) the Institute for Technology Development, Stennis Space Center, (2) Hydrodyne Technology Research.
